COLD POTATO SALAD

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 20 minutes
Total Time: 30 minutes
Cuisine: Indian Author: Aaisha
Ingredients
2 potatoes (boiled and cut into bite size cubes)
1 medium onion rough chopped
1/2 cup each green peas and corn (Boiled)
200 gm yogurt
1 tsp chaat masala
1 tsp salt
1/2 tsp cumin powder
paste of 3-4 green chilies For tempering
1/2 tsp whole cumin
10-12 curry leaves
1-2 tbsp olive oil
Instructions
Boil the potatoes in a pan and the peas and corn in another pan. Strain the peas and the corn under cold running. When the potatoes are done, strain, peel and Cut into bite size cubes.
In a bowl add the chopped onion, the green peas and potatoes. Add 1/2 tsp each of the chaat masala, cumin powder and salt to the bowl of veggies and toss.
In another bowl whip the yogurt and add the green chili paste and the remaining 1/2 tsp each of salt and the chaat masala. Mix and pour the mixture over the potatoes and toss it gently.
Heat oil in a pan, add the whole cumin and the curry leaves. When they start crackling put off heat and pour it over the salad. Give the salad a gentle toss.
Cover and keep in the fridge to cool for at least an hour.
Serve as a side with your favorite dishes.

Recipe Tips-
You can drizzle your salad with the sweet and sour Tamarind Chutney.
Tempering is optional. I like my yoghurt tempered with curry leaves so I did. If for any reason you don’t want to, you are free to skip it.
Make sure you allow the salad to cool because as the name says ‘Cold Potato Salad’ it needs a good few minutes of chilling in the fridge.
